Abstract

PURPOSE:To eliminate wiping tremble on a wiper without using washer liquid, by decreasing pressure force of the wiper to the window glass when trembling occurs on the wiper when wiping raindrops. CONSTITUTION:When raindrop wiping with a wiper 2 is going on smoothly, a heater 16 is in operative condition, and a pressure force adjusting measure 5 is contracted due to temperature rise more than an appointed temperature. Thereby, a sprig 2e of the wiper 2 is elongated and the pressure force of the wiper blade 2a becomes large. When trembling occurs on the wiper, the heater 16 becomes inoperative, therefore the pressure force adjusting measure 5 becomes slackened due to the temperature drop lower than the appointed temperature. Thereby the wiper spring 2e is contracted to that amount, and the pressure force of the wiper blade decreases and the trembling disappears.
